Patrol area, then wandering off... Historic?
This may have been discussed before.
When out on a patrol I end up going to my grid, spend 24h there (although I know with GWX 2.1 I will not get a thing for it which is fine with me) then go mostly closer to the shore or ports for hunting. Is this historic? Did the skips wander of or did they stay in the area assigned. Staying in the area for 24h only makes absolutely no sense to me to be honest. What do you think? The reason I am wondering off all the time is that I am early in 1940 with a IIA. Not enough renown to upgrade but I also put in for a transfer to Wilhelmshaven. So with that boat it is kind of though to chase anything plus the hydrophones are weak. I need to position myself a bit better than just sitting in a grid somewhere in the middle of the North Sea. |

U-boats were often moved from their allotted patrol areas by Control as reports of convoy sightings were evaluated.
If or when you play GWX2.1 it won't really matter because all patrol related renown is no longer included. The only renown awarded is for destruction of enemy units. In RL, most U-boats that returned (especially in late war) failed to sink or even see anything. Because of the Allies ability to accurately read German code, most convoys were diverted away from known U-boat locations. ![]() |
